How should founders evaluate these domains?

Favor names with clear math relevance, easy spelling, and an extension that still feels credible to customers. Avoid picks where the novelty of the TLD does all the work.

How should investors judge this set?

Focus on buyer depth for the keyword, extension liquidity, renewal risk, and whether the name can attract demand without needing a highly specific use case.

What are the main risks in this selection?

The main risks are weak extension credibility, uncertain resale depth, possible high renewals on niche TLDs, and names that look clever but lack clear buyer demand.
